It will require 4 to five hrs to hike in the car park to Wineglass Bay, to Dangers Seaside, and again all over to the car park in a loop. The route is well-signposted and simple to uncover.

With the Seaside you follow the path with the bush, around the isthmus and pop out at the point on Dangers Beach.

Through the saddle, you may descend about one thousand stairs to reach the beach. Yet another twenty-minute walk along the sand towards the southern end of the Beach front reveals magnificent sights back again in the direction of the Hazards.

he initial 50 % of the walk to Wineglass Bay is Walk D (towards the lookout), then go on on downhill to this fantastic bay with its lengthy white sandy Beach front and crystal obvious seas.

The Hazards, a hanging line of granite peaks, kind a spectacular barrier through the park, While using the Wineglass Bay Lookout providing breathtaking views from among the passes.
